Proper noun

Alva

  1. a small town in Clackmannanshire council area, Scotland (OS grid ref NS8897)
  2. a village on the island of Gotland, Sweden.
  3. a CDP in Lee County, Florida, USA.
  4. an unincorporated community in Harlan County, Kentucky, USA.
  5. a city in Oklahoma, USA, and the county seat of Woods County.
  6. an unincorporated community in Crook County, Wyoming, USA.

Swedish

Etymology

A 19th century feminine form of Alf, or a short form of female compound names beginning with Alf-, such as Alfhild and Alfrida.

Proper noun

Alva c (genitive Alvas)

  1. A female given name.
